Hey, just adding a few more: Woodbourne Tower: 122.8 Woodbourne Ground: 118.1 Woodbourne ATIS: 126.05 Ohakea Control (Wanganui, Fielding, OH): 120.4 Ohakea Control can be heard perfectly from pretty much everywhere in Wanganui.

There are two Boing VC-25's in the video but there can never be two Air Force Ones. Air Force One is the call sign for the aircraft carrying the President of USA at the time, regardless of aircraft type. Unless the Lizard overlords have cloned the president, there is only one POTUS.
